Porter quits PC Zone?

pczone.jpg

Ram Raider's rumouring that longstanding PCZone editor Will Porter is to quit, following previous recent departures from Ed Zitron and Jamie Sefton.

Staffer Jon Blyth is also thought to be leaving.

The Future magazine has, according to the mysterious blogger, had its page count and budget reduced, and its frequency pushed up to 14 issues a year.

Anyone who's ever spoken to any of these guys will know that none of this comes as a gigantic shock, frankly.

About the Author
Patrick Garratt avatar

Patrick Garratt

Founder & Publisher (Former)

Patrick Garratt is a games media legend - and not just by reputation. He was named as such in the UK's 'Games Media Awards', the equivalent of a lifetime achievement award. After garnering experience on countless gaming magazines, he joined Eurogamer and later split from that brand to create VG247, putting the site on the map with fast, 24-hour a day coverage, and assembling the site's earliest editorial teams. He retired from VG247, and the games industry, in 2017.
